Mysore Palace
Starting with the city’s most famous monument, the Mysore Palace impresses with its stunning architecture and grand interiors. Known for its intricate design and historical significance, the palace is especially magical at night when illuminated, and during Dasara, the palace hosts a spectacular light show. Though the tour doesn’t include the admission fee, you’ll get plenty of time to appreciate the exterior and snap photos of this majestic building. Expect about an hour here, focusing on the visual grandeur and stories your driver shares about its history.
St. Philomena’s Church
Next, the route takes you to St. Philomena’s Church, an impressive Gothic-style structure. Its soaring spires and stained-glass windows depicting scenes from Christ’s life make it a standout and a peaceful stop. It’s free to enter, giving you a chance to soak in the architecture without extra cost. About 30 minutes is usually enough to admire the artistry and take some photos.
Jaganmohan Palace & Art Gallery
A short ride from the church, the Jaganmohan Palace now houses a notable art gallery. The collection includes works by famous Indian artists like Raja Ravi Varma, making it a cultural highlight. If art and history interest you, this stop offers a quiet, enriching experience. Expect about an hour exploring the gallery — entrance fees are not included, but the focus is on the artistic treasures and the stories behind them.
Devaraja Market
For a taste of local flavor, the bustling Devaraja Market is a must. It’s lively, chaotic, and full of color—from fresh spices and flowers to handcrafted souvenirs. This market offers a direct window into Mysore’s vibrant daily life. About 30 minutes here is enough to browse and perhaps pick up some unique local products. It’s a sensory overload, and your driver can help you navigate the best stalls.
Chamundi Hills
Finally, no visit to Mysore is complete without a trip to Chamundi Hills. The panoramic views of the city from the top are stunning, and the temple dedicated to Goddess Chamundeshwari is a pilgrimage site with a commanding presence. You can climb the 1,000 steps or take a cab—your driver will likely suggest the best option based on your preferences. An hour is usually allotted for this stop, giving you time to enjoy the view and soak in the spiritual atmosphere at the temple.
